You may think these photos show people enjoying a party, but look a little closer…

on Twitter, appear to depict fun, candid moments at a party. Though the faces may look real enough, they are, in fact, amalgamations of countless faces conjured by a machine.

Twitter user @mileszim created some creepy AI-generated photos of people at a party–but some things in the pictures are slightly off.In the AI-generated photos uploaded by @mileszim, some of the “people” had extra body parts growing out of them.“Midjourney is getting crazy powerful—none of these are real photos, and none of the people in them exist,” Miles wrote in the caption of his Twitter post.
